DNI Group Makes $1 Million Investment in Neem, Pakistan’s Embedded Finance Startup

Leading embedded finance platform Neem and prominent investment firm DNI Group have announced a strategic investment partnership aimed at fostering innovation and growth within the embedded finance space in Pakistan.

Neem’s co-founder, Vladimira Briestenska, revealed to a local news medium that the investment size for this partnership amounts to $1 million.

This collaboration entails a substantial investment by DNI Group into Neem, with a focus on creating synergies across the broader financial wellness landscape through product-led initiatives.

The partnership signifies a strong commitment to the embedded finance industry and showcases a shared vision for transforming the financial landscape in Pakistan. Neem’s financial infrastructure and Banking-as-a-Service (BaaS) capabilities enable digital platforms to offer comprehensive embedded financial services to underserved customers.

Ross Venter, CEO of DNI’s technology arm, Digital Ecosystems, expressed excitement about the partnership, stating, 

“Neem’s goal of providing financial wellness to the Pakistani market aligns with DNI’s own objectives around empowering people and enhancing financial and digital inclusion. Through DNI’s strategic investment into Neem, we hope to fast-track the development, exchange, and commercialization of our respective technologies for the benefit of consumers within our global communities.”

The partnership between DNI Group and Neem aims to advance financial wellness, particularly for underserved communities. This collaboration further strengthens Neem’s Financial Wellness thesis, empowering businesses and individuals to take control of their financial lives.

Neem has already established product partnerships with several companies within DNI Group’s portfolio, including Airvantage in the airtime lending space and Paymenow in the earned wage access sector.

Vladimira Briestenska, co-founder of Neem, expressed enthusiasm about the partnership, stating, 

“The partnership and investment from DNI Group, a team of seasoned operators with global expertise, serve as a powerful testament. It showcases their confidence in the embedded finance model, our Neem team’s strong execution capabilities, and, above all, our shared vision of empowering Financial Wellness for communities in Pakistan and across emerging markets worldwide. We are excited about this major milestone in our journey at Neem.”

Despite global macro-climates, Pakistan’s digital ecosystem continues to thrive, and Neem remains committed to building financial resilience and economic prosperity for people within Pakistan and beyond.

The strategic investment partnership between Neem and DNI Group not only sends a significant signal to the market and the digital ecosystem but also reinforces the importance of serving underserved communities.

CWPK Legacy
Launched in 1967 internationally, ComputerWorld is the oldest tech magazine/media property in the world. In Pakistan, ComputerWorld was launched in 1995. Initially providing news to IT executives only, once CIO Pakistan, its sister brand from the same family, was launched and took over the enterprise reporting domain in Pakistan, CWPK has emerged as a holistic technology media platform reporting everything tech in the country. It remains the oldest continuous IT publishing brand in the country and in 2025 is set to turn 30 years old, which will be its biggest benchmark and a legacy it hopes to continue for years to come. CWPK is part of the SPIN/IDG Wakhan media umbrella.
